Financial Results

Sierra Health Foundation maintains a global and broadly diversified portfolio with allocations to a variety of asset classes, both public and private. Earnings from our investment portfolio are the foundation’s primary source of funds.

2021 Financial Results

At the end of 2021, assets totaled $63,413,007.

 

2021 Program Services and Operating Expenses

Public Policy and Education Program
$918,811

General Administration
$619,187

San Joaquin Valley Health Fund
$141,344Nonprofit Health Sector Development
$96,615

Improving Health and Quality of Life
$72,815

Responsive Grants Program
$46,391

Youth Development
$22,197

Total = $1,917,360
